Prepare Your Space for Success
Preparing the space is essential for a successful painting project. Clearing the area of furniture and personal items ensures that the work can continue without disruptions. Additionally, protecting belongings with coverings or moving them to a safe location decreases the likelihood of injury during the painting process.
Remove Items from the Area
Before starting a painting endeavor, it's crucial to clear the area to set up a productive area. This process involves clearing out furniture, decor, and other items that could obstruct the painting process. A tidy space not only improves access for the contractors but also minimizes the risk of accidental damage to belongings. It is wise to relocate bulkier pieces to a different room or, if needed, to the center of the space and cover them with a drop cloth for additional safety. Additionally, any wall hangings, light fixtures, or outlet covers should be detached to guarantee a even workspace for painting. By completely preparing the space, homeowners create the foundation for a more effective and high-quality painting experience.
Guard Your Personal Items
To safeguard belongings during a painting project, homeowners should take proactive steps in protecting their possessions. First, they must remove all items from the area being painted, including furniture, decor, and electronics. For larger items that cannot be moved, covering them with drop cloths or plastic sheeting can prevent paint splatters and dust accumulation. Additionally, homeowners should secure any valuable items, either by moving them to a different room or placing them in protective storage. It is also wise to tape or cover light switches, outlets, and flooring to minimize potential damage. Taking these precautions not only protects belongings but also creates a smoother and more efficient painting process, ensuring a successful transformation of the space.

Keeping Your Beautifully Painted Walls in Top Condition
Once the right professionals have been hired and a stunning paint job has been completed, preserving those beautifully painted walls becomes the primary focus for homeowners. Regular upkeep is essential to preserve the vibrancy and integrity of the paint. Since dust and dirt tend to build up, it is advisable to clean gently with a soft cloth or sponge and mild soap to prevent surface damage.
Homeowners should likewise remain aware of fluctuations in humidity and temperature, which can damage both the paint and the surface underneath. Employing a dehumidifier in areas with excess moisture can stop peeling and mildew from developing.
Some touch-ups might be needed as time goes on; storing additional paint for this reason ensures consistent color matching. Additionally, steering clear of abrasive cleaning tools and strong chemicals will preserve the finish. By following these guidelines, homeowners can appreciate their elegantly painted walls for many years, improving the overall look of their living areas.

Advanced Texture Solutions
Even though classic painting approaches have their place, modern texture methods provide a unique approach to interior spaces. Methods like sponging, rag rolling, and stucco finishes have the power to turn walls into striking visual features. These methods create depth and dimension, allowing homeowners to express their unique style. Moreover, materials including plaster or wood may be introduced to heighten sensory appeal, making rooms feel more welcoming. Textured finishes can also help conceal imperfections, providing a practical benefit alongside aesthetic appeal. As the desire for individualized interiors continues to rise, expert contractors have developed greater expertise in these modern methods, making certain that each result reflects the client's unique preferences. At their core, these inventive methods raise living spaces well above the standard of traditional flat finishes.
Vibrant Color Contrasts
Colour serves as a powerful asset in interior design, especially when it comes to creating bold contrasts that invigorate a space. Experienced interior contractors often apply imaginative approaches to achieve striking visual effects. A popular approach includes combining dark tones with lighter shades to create depth and drama, enhancing architectural features. Accent walls offer another opportunity; a rich tone can draw attention to a specific area, such as a fireplace or artwork. Furthermore, employing color blocking—where bold colors are placed in structured patterns—adds a modern touch. By experimenting with unexpected pairings, such as matching cerulean with amber or sage with blush, homeowners can create a distinctive look. At their best, dramatic color contrasts revitalize interiors, converting everyday spaces into remarkable rooms.

Which Paint Types Do Professional Contractors Recommend?
Professional contractors typically recommend premium latex paint products for interior painting projects due to their long-lasting performance and simple maintenance. For outdoor surfaces, they frequently recommend acrylic-based paint products, which offer superior protection against the elements and enduring color vibrancy.
Are Eco-Friendly Painting Solutions Available?
Eco-friendly painting options are indeed available. Experienced painting professionals frequently suggest low-VOC and zero-VOC paints, which work to lower harmful emissions and lessen environmental impact, while promoting healthier indoor air quality and offering a wide range of colors and finishes.
Am I Able to Stay in My House During the Painting Process?
Yes, homeowners can often remain in their homes during the painting process. Nevertheless, homeowners should avoid freshly painted sections to minimize fume exposure and maintain overall safety, most notably in confined spaces where proper ventilation could be restricted.
